About this House

Spacious 2 bedroom 1 bath home located in great neighborhood. Home needs some TLC but has potential for a great flip or investment property. Roof replaced in 2019. Home has an extra room that could be used as 3rd bedroom. Crawlspace has been checked on a regular basis thru Wheeler Exterminating.
618 Daughety Road, Kinston, NC 28501 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,240 sqft single-family home built in 1951. It last sold for $55,000 on Sep 30, 2025 (15% below the $65,000 asking price). This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$70,500, with a rent estimate of $952/month.
